Method: projects.assets.create

HTTP request
POST https://earthengine.googleapis.com/v1alpha/{parent=projects/*}/assets
The URL uses gRPC Transcoding syntax.
Path parameters
Parameters |
parent |
string
Required. The parent of the asset collection (e.g., "projects/*").
Authorization requires the following IAM permission on the specified resource parent :
earthengine.assets.create
|
Query parameters
Parameters |
assetId |
string
The ID of the asset to create. Equivalent to name but without the "projects/*/assets" (e.g., users/[USER]/[ASSET]).
|
overwrite |
boolean
Whether to allow overwriting an image asset.
|
Request body
The request body contains an instance of EarthEngineAsset
.
Response body
If successful, the response body contains a newly created instance of EarthEngineAsset
.
Authorization scopes
Requires one of the following OAuth scopes:
https://www.googleapis.com/auth/earthengine
https://www.googleapis.com/auth/cloud-platform
For more information, see the OAuth 2.0 Overview.
